Geospatial Analytics and Historical Data Integration for Enhanced Insurance Risk Assessment

Keywords: Geospatial Analytics, Insurance Risk Assessment, Location-Based Pricing, Catastrophe Modeling, Data-Driven Underwriting.

Abstract: This article examines the transformative impact of integrating location-specific data and historical trends into insurance risk assessment frameworks. Traditional insurance methodologies rely on generalized demographic and behavioral variables, often failing to capture nuanced environmental factors that significantly impact actual risk profiles. The integration of geographic variables—including natural disaster frequency, climate patterns, crime statistics, and infrastructure quality—represents a paradigm shift in premium calculation accuracy. Through advanced technological infrastructure, including Geographic Information Systems (GIS), big data analytics, and machine learning algorithms, insurers can develop multidimensional risk profiles that far exceed the precision of traditional underwriting approaches. The article evaluates the empirical evidence supporting location-based risk factors across various insurance lines, explores stakeholder impacts, addresses regulatory and ethical considerations, and identifies implementation challenges. By embracing these technological innovations, the insurance industry can achieve more equitable premium distribution while improving operational efficiency and customer satisfaction.
